Borr Drilling appoints Dr. Jeff Currie and CEO Patrick Schorn to its Board of Directors

– BERMUDA, Hamilton –  Borr Drilling Limited (OSE: BORR | NYSE: BORR) today announced the appointments of Dr. Jeff Currie (PhD) and current CEO Patrick Schorn to its Board of Directors effective from 16 October 2023.

Mr. Schorn became CEO of Borr Drilling in September 2020, after serving as a Director of the Board since January 2018.

About Jeffrey Currie

Jeffrey Currie recently retired from Goldman Sachs after a decorated 27-year career. For the last 15 years, he was a Partner and the Global Head of Commodities Research where he was responsible for conducting research on commodity market dynamics in the context of corporate risk management programs, short and long-term commodity investment strategies, and asset allocation. He also held roles as the European Co-Head of Economics, Commodities, and Strategy Research between 2010 and 2012. Since his retirement, Jeff has joined the board of Abaxx Technologies and The University of Chicago’s Energy Policy Institute where he serves as the Chairman of the Advisory Board.

Prior to joining Goldman Sachs, Mr. Currie taught undergraduate and graduate-level courses in microeconomics and econometrics at The University of Chicago and served as the associate editor of Resource and Energy Economics. Jeff also worked as a consulting economist, specializing in energy and other microeconomic issues, and has advised many government agencies. Jeff earned a Ph.D. in Economics from The University of Chicago in 1996.
